Drug/Alcohol Sanctions

Summary of Drug/Alcohol Sanctions for Students

Alcohol Offense off Campus (Self Reported) – 1st offense

The nature of the offense will determine if the Dean advises the Principal to convene the Disciplinary Review Board.

 If the board does not convene the sanction is: 

1.                  drug/alcohol evaluation

2.                  minimum 15 hours of service

3.                  minimum 1 week suspension from all non-academic school activities, effective immediately 

Alcohol Offense off Campus (Self Reported) – 2nd offense (in a career) 

The nature of the offense will determine if the Dean advises the Principal to convene the Disciplinary Review Board.

If the board does not convene the sanction is:

1.                  drug/alcohol evaluation

2.                  minimum of 30 hours of service

3.                  minimum 2 week suspension from all non-academic school activities, effective immediately

4.                  disciplinary probation

5.                  if the student participates in co-curricular activities, he will serve a suspension from his activity(s) that equates to a minimum of 25% of upcoming competitions or performances. 

a.       This suspension may coincide with and is not in addition to the 2 week suspension listed above, assuming the offense happens in season.

b.      If 25% of the season does not remain, this suspension will extend into the following co-curricular’s season.  (The Dean will determine how the percentages translate.)

c.       If the pending suspension is judged too distant by the Dean, an alternate sanction may be imposed at the Dean’s discretion.

Alcohol Offense off Campus (Self Reported) – 3rd offense (in a career)

1.                  violation of probation – Disciplinary Review Board
